					When wide-screen video is played, this mode clips the right and left   
					sides of the image so that it can be viewed on a conventional screen.   
					Some wide-screen DVDs that do not permit Pan Scan mode playback   
					are automatically played in letterbox mode (black bands that appear   
					at the top and bottom of the screen).

					Cleaning the Disc   
					A defective or soiled disc inserted into the unit can cause sound to drop out during playback.   
					Handle the disc by holding its inner and outer edges.   
					Do NOT touch the surface of the unlabeled side of the disc.   
					Do NOT stick paper or tape on the surface.   
					Do NOT expose the disc to direct sunlight or excessive heat.   
					Clean the disc before playback. Wipe the disc from the center outward   
					with a cleaning cloth.   
					NEVER use solvents such as benzine or alcohol to clean the disc.   
					Do NOT use irregular shaped discs (example: heart shaped, octagonal, etc.). They may   
					cause malfunctions.

					Do not use the unit in places that are extremely hot, cold, dusty, or humid.   
					Place the unit on a flat and even surface.   
					Be sure to turn the unit off and disconnect the AC power adapter before maintaining the unit.   
					Wipe the unit with a dry soft cloth. If the surfaces are extremely dirty, wipe clean with a cloth   
					that has been dipped in a weak soap-and-water solution and wrung out thoroughly, then   
					wipe with a dry cloth.   
					Never use alcohol, benzine, thinner, cleaning fluid or other chemicals. Do NOT use   
					compressed air to remove dust.

					When left in a heated room where it is warm and damp, water droplets or condensation may   
					form inside the unit. When there is condensation inside the unit, the unit may not function   
					normally. Let the unit stand for 1 to 2 hours before turning the power on, or gradually heat   
					the room and allow the unit to dry before use.

					NOTE: This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B digital   
					device, pursuant to Part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ide reasonable   
					protection against harmful interference in a residential installation. This equipment generates,   
					uses and can radiate radio fr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with   
					the instructions, may cause harmful interference to radio communications. However, there is   
					no guarantee that interference will not occur in a particular installation. If this equipment does   
					cause harmful interference to radio or television reception, which can be determined by turning   
					the equipment off and on, the user is encouraged to try to correct the interference by one or   
					more of the following measures:
